    Hi - I have the same car - 64 LeSabre convertible. I just rebuilt the entire brake system. To remove the drums off of the spindles, remove the cap, remove the cotter pin and unscrew the big nut, and just wiggle the drum until it pops off of the spindle. Don't forget to catch the bearing.
